package builtin
// #include <stdio.h>
// #include <stdlib.h>
import "C"
import (
"reflect"
"unsafe"
. "github.com/godot-go/godot-go/pkg/ffi"
"github.com/godot-go/godot-go/pkg/log"
)
type GoStringFormat uint8
const (
Latin1GoStringFormat GoStringFormat = iota
Utf8GoStringFormat
)
func createGoStringEncoder(format GoStringFormat) argumentEncoder[string, String] {
tfn := typeFromVariantConstructor[GDEXTENSION_VARIANT_TYPE_STRING]
vfn := variantFromTypeConstructor[GDEXTENSION_VARIANT_TYPE_STRING]
var fmtfn func(GDExtensionConstStringPtr, *Char, GDExtensionInt) GDExtensionInt
var createfn func(GDExtensionUninitializedStringPtr, string)
switch format {
case Latin1GoStringFormat:
fmtfn = CallFunc_GDExtensionInterfaceStringToLatin1Chars
createfn = CallFunc_GDExtensionInterfaceStringNewWithLatin1Chars
case Utf8GoStringFormat:
fmtfn = CallFunc_GDExtensionInterfaceStringToUtf8Chars
createfn = CallFunc_GDExtensionInterfaceStringNewWithUtf8Chars
default:
log.Panic("unexpected go string encoder format")
}
decodeTypePtrArg := func(ptr GDExtensionConstTypePtr, pOut *string) {
size := fmtfn((GDExtensionConstStringPtr)(ptr),
(*Char)(nullptr),
(GDExtensionInt)(0),
)
cstrSlice := make([]C.char, int(size)+1)
cstr := (*C.char)(unsafe.SliceData(cstrSlice))
fmtfn(
(GDExtensionConstStringPtr)(ptr),
(*Char)(cstr),
(GDExtensionInt)(size+1),
)
*pOut = C.GoString(cstr)[:]
}
decodeTypePtr := func(ptr GDExtensionConstTypePtr) string {
var out string
decodeTypePtrArg(ptr, &out)
return out
}
encodeTypePtrArg := func(in string, out GDExtensionUninitializedTypePtr) {
createfn((GDExtensionUninitializedStringPtr)(out), in)
}
encodeTypePtr := func(in string) GDExtensionTypePtr {
var out String
pOut := (GDExtensionTypePtr)(&out)
encodeTypePtrArg(in, (GDExtensionUninitializedTypePtr)(pOut))
return pOut
}
decodeVariantPtrArg := func(ptr GDExtensionConstVariantPtr, pOut *string) {
var enc String
pEnc := (GDExtensionTypePtr)(unsafe.Pointer(&enc))
CallFunc_GDExtensionTypeFromVariantConstructorFunc(tfn, (GDExtensionUninitializedTypePtr)(pEnc), (GDExtensionVariantPtr)(ptr))
defer enc.Destroy()
decodeTypePtrArg((GDExtensionConstTypePtr)(pEnc), pOut)
}
decodeVariantPtr := func(ptr GDExtensionConstVariantPtr) string {
var out string
decodeVariantPtrArg(ptr, &out)
return out
}
encodeVariantPtrArg := func(in string, pOut GDExtensionUninitializedVariantPtr) {
var enc String
pEnc := (GDExtensionTypePtr)(unsafe.Pointer(&enc))
encodeTypePtrArg(in, (GDExtensionUninitializedTypePtr)(pEnc))
CallFunc_GDExtensionVariantFromTypeConstructorFunc(vfn, pOut, pEnc)
defer enc.Destroy()
}
encodeVariantPtr := func(in string) GDExtensionVariantPtr {
var out Variant
pOut := (GDExtensionVariantPtr)(unsafe.Pointer(&out))
encodeVariantPtrArg(in, (GDExtensionUninitializedVariantPtr)(pOut))
return pOut
}
decodeReflectTypePtr := func(ptr GDExtensionConstTypePtr) reflect.Value {
content := decodeTypePtr(ptr)
return reflect.ValueOf(content)
}
encodeReflectTypePtrArg := func(rv reflect.Value, pOut GDExtensionUninitializedTypePtr) {
content := rv.String()
encodeTypePtrArg(content, pOut)
}
encodeReflectTypePtr := func(rv reflect.Value) GDExtensionTypePtr {
var out String
pOut := (GDExtensionTypePtr)(&out)
encodeReflectTypePtrArg(rv, (GDExtensionUninitializedTypePtr)(pOut))
return pOut
}
decodeReflectVariantPtr := func(ptr GDExtensionConstVariantPtr) reflect.Value {
var v String
CallFunc_GDExtensionTypeFromVariantConstructorFunc(tfn, (GDExtensionUninitializedTypePtr)(v.NativePtr()), (GDExtensionVariantPtr)(ptr))
return reflect.ValueOf(v)
}
encodeReflectVariantPtrArg := func(rv reflect.Value, pOut GDExtensionUninitializedVariantPtr) {
content := rv.String()
var enc String
pEnc := (GDExtensionTypePtr)(unsafe.Pointer(&enc))
encodeTypePtrArg(content, (GDExtensionUninitializedTypePtr)(pEnc))
CallFunc_GDExtensionVariantFromTypeConstructorFunc(vfn, pOut, pEnc)
}
encodeReflectVariantPtr := func(rv reflect.Value) GDExtensionVariantPtr {
var out Variant
pOut := (GDExtensionVariantPtr)(unsafe.Pointer(&out))
encodeReflectVariantPtrArg(rv, (GDExtensionUninitializedVariantPtr)(pOut))
return pOut
}
return argumentEncoder[string, String]{
DecodeTypePtrArg: decodeTypePtrArg,
DecodeTypePtr: decodeTypePtr,
EncodeTypePtrArg: encodeTypePtrArg,
EncodeTypePtr: encodeTypePtr,
DecodeVariantPtrArg: decodeVariantPtrArg,
DecodeVariantPtr: decodeVariantPtr,
EncodeVariantPtrArg: encodeVariantPtrArg,
EncodeVariantPtr: encodeVariantPtr,
decodeReflectTypePtr: decodeReflectTypePtr,
encodeReflectTypePtrArg: encodeReflectTypePtrArg,
encodeReflectTypePtr: encodeReflectTypePtr,
decodeReflectVariantPtr: decodeReflectVariantPtr,
encodeReflectVariantPtrArg: encodeReflectVariantPtrArg,
encodeReflectVariantPtr: encodeReflectVariantPtr,
}
}
